首页
/ FreeScout中更新已过期的Microsoft 365 OAuth密钥指南

FreeScout中更新已过期的Microsoft 365 OAuth密钥指南

2025-06-24 09:08:02作者:冯爽妲Honey

在使用FreeScout邮件帮助台系统时,许多用户会配置Microsoft 365的OAuth认证来实现邮件的自动收发。当OAuth密钥过期时,系统将无法继续获取新邮件,这是许多管理员会遇到的一个常见问题。

问题现象

当Microsoft 365的OAuth客户端密钥过期时,FreeScout会在获取邮件时显示错误信息,提示"AADSTS7000222: The provided client secret keys are expired"。此时虽然系统状态显示为"Active",但实际上邮件获取功能已经中断,而发送邮件功能可能仍然正常工作。

解决方案

要解决这个问题,需要完成以下步骤:

  1. 登录Azure AD门户(现称为Microsoft Entra ID)
  2. 导航到"应用注册"部分,找到为FreeScout创建的应用程序
  3. 选择"证书和密码"选项卡
  4. 创建新的客户端密钥(Client Secret)
  5. 复制新生成的密钥值

完成上述步骤后,返回FreeScout管理界面:

  1. 进入邮箱设置中的"获取邮件"配置部分
  2. 在密码字段中输入新创建的客户端密钥
  3. 系统可能会显示"断开连接"选项,点击它以重新建立连接

注意事项

  • Microsoft 365的客户端密钥通常有特定的有效期(如12个月、24个月或永不过期),建议记录密钥的到期时间
  • 对于生产环境,建议在密钥到期前提前创建新密钥并更新配置,避免服务中断
  • 考虑设置定期提醒,以便在密钥到期前及时更新
  • 如果系统没有自动显示"断开连接"选项,可以尝试先保存配置再重新编辑

通过以上步骤,可以恢复FreeScout与Microsoft 365的邮件获取功能,确保帮助台系统继续正常工作。对于关键业务系统,建议将此流程纳入常规维护计划,以预防类似问题的发生。

登录后查看全文
热门项目推荐
相关项目推荐